Definition
The Hungarian Forint (HUF) is a major fiat currency of Central Europe, while the Chilean Peso (CLP) is the primary currency of Chile. The exchange rate between them reflects market sentiment regarding both currencies’ relative strength and stability in the foreign exchange market.
